Storm Damage Restoration: DIY vs. Professional Help

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Minor wind damage to siding (e.g., one loose piece) Yes No Easily repaired with basic tools and materials.
Small amount of water on tile floor from a leaky window seal Yes No Can be mopped up and dried with fans.
Heavy rain causing significant water intrusion in a finished basement with standing water No Yes Requires specialized equipment for extraction and drying to prevent mold and structural damage.
Roof shingles blown off by high winds, exposing decking No Yes Requires professional assessment of roof integrity and proper repair to prevent further leaks.
A tree branch has fallen on your garage roof, causing a hole No Yes Safety risk and requires immediate structural stabilization and repair.
Wet drywall behind cabinets after a roof leak No Yes Needs professional drying and assessment for mold potential before repairs.

While minor cosmetic issues might be manageable for a DIYer, any situation involving significant water intrusion, structural compromise, or potential safety hazards absolutely requires professional Storm Damage Restoration. Storm Damage Restoration Cost In The 84092 Area

The cost of Storm Damage Restoration can vary significantly based on the extent of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the specific materials and methods needed for your property in the 84092 area. These figures are general estimates and are not guarantees. Costs depend on the damage scope. We provide transparent pricing.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Emergency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Amount of water, type of flooring, and accessibility.
Structural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000+ Size of the affected area, saturation levels, and duration of drying.
Roof and Siding Repair (minor) $300 – $1,500 Type of material, size of the damaged section, and complexity of the repair.
Debris Removal and Site Cleanup $200 – $1,000 Volume and type of debris, and necessary equipment for removal.
Emergency Board-Up $200 – $800 Number of openings to secure and materials needed.
Mold Assessment and Containment (if needed) $500 – $2,000 Size of the affected area and complexity of containment setup.

How do I know if I have hidden water damage?

Signs of hidden water damage include musty odors, unexplained damp spots on walls or ceilings, peeling paint or wallpaper, and warped flooring. If you suspect hidden moisture, it’s important to have it professionally inspected. We use moisture meters. We find hidden problems.

Is mold a risk after storm damage?

Yes, mold can begin to grow within 24-48 hours in damp conditions. Prompt water extraction and thorough drying are crucial to prevent mold development. If mold is found, we follow strict remediation protocols. Preventing mold is essential. We handle mold safely.

What’s the difference between storm damage and general wear and tear?

Storm damage is typically sudden and accidental, caused by external forces like wind, rain, or hail. Wear and tear refers to gradual deterioration from normal use and aging. Insurance generally covers storm damage but not wear and tear. We distinguish between damage types. We document storm-related issues.
